BitBake
보이기
발표일 | 2004년 12월 7일[1] |
---|---|
안정화 버전 | 1.46.0[2]
/ 2020년 4월 21일 |
저장소 | |
프로그래밍 언어 | 파이썬 |
운영 체제 | 리눅스 |
플랫폼 | 크로스 플랫폼 |
종류 | 빌드 자동화 |
라이선스 | GPLv2 |
상태 | 지원 중 |
웹사이트 | [1] |
BitBake는 임베디드 리눅스의 크로스 컴파일 과정을 위한 패키지와 관련파일들을 빌드하는 데 사용되는 툴이다.
BitBake Recipes
[편집]BitBake recipes는 특정패키지에 대한 빌드방법을 구체화하고, 패키지들의 의존성, 위치, 설정법, 컴파일, 빌드, 설치 및 제거정보를 포함한다. 그리고 패키지의 메타데이터 정보를 표준화된 변수들로 가지고 있다.
BitBake recipes는 패키지의 소스 URL (http, https, ftp, cvs, svn, git, 로컬 파일 시스템), 패키지간의 의존성, 컴파일, 설치옵션들로 구성되어있다. 빌드 진행중에 BitBake recipes는 패키지의 의존성을 추적하고, 네이티브 혹은 크로스 컴파일을 로컬 혹은 타겟 장치에 맞게 수행한다. 루트 파일 시스템과 완전한 이미지를 생성할 수 있다. 또한 타겟 플랫폼에 맞는 크로스 컴파일 툴체인을 생성한다.
같이 보기
[편집]각주
[편집]- ↑ “Re: [yocto] Happy Birthday, Yocto Project”. 2013년 11월 15일.
- ↑ “Releases”.
외부 링크
[편집]이 글은 리눅스에 관한 토막글입니다. 여러분의 지식으로 알차게 문서를 완성해 갑시다. |